Certified NICEIC Electrician (Commissioning)
Location
Bracknell, Berkshire | United Kingdom

Who are we looking for?
We are growing rapidly and looking for a Certified NICEIC Electrician who will confidentially manage the final stages of our Smart Technology Solution installation before handover to our client - Meet Conqora, Smart Technology Solution for Hospitality developed by KCP Network:
Responsibilities
- Install, maintain, and repair electrical systems, as well as be the one to manage the final stages before handover to our client in accordance with NICEIC regulations and company procedures
- Carry out periodic inspection and testing of electrical systems to ensure compliance and safety standards.
- Identify electrical faults and troubleshoot issues effectively and efficiently
- Perform electrical installations and upgrades, applying knowledge of electrical theory and principles
- Collaborate with colleagues and clients to understand project requirements and provide expert advice, solutions including providing a realistic timeline
- Conduct risk assessments to identify potential hazards and implement appropriate control measures
- Maintain accurate records of work activities, including maintenance logs and job reports
Requirements
- Certified NICEIC Electrician with a proven track record of performing electrical installations, maintenance, and repairs
- 18th Edition BS 7671:2018 Certificate
- CSCS Electrician card
- Extensive knowledge of electrical systems, components, and wiring regulations
- Proficient in reading technical diagrams and blueprints
- Strong analytical and problem-solving skills to identify and resolve electrical issues
- Excellent attention to detail and the ability to work accurately under pressure
- Effective communication skills to collaborate with team members and clients
- Health and safety conscious, adhering to regulations and best practices to ensure a safe working environment
- Ability to work independently and as part of a team, demonstrating flexibility and adaptability in a fast-paced environment
